Celebrate Lancaster Speedways 50th anniversary in 2008 with John Biscis LANCASTER HEROES pictorial. Relive the golden era of asphalt Modified racing at historic Lancaster Speedway near Buffalo, N.Y., from 1966-1976. In its heyday, Lancaster Speedway played host to some of the biggest names and events in Modified racing. LANCASTER HEROES is a full-sized soft-cover book (8.5x11 inches), with 128 pages and 452 black-and-white photos. (Photos by Gordon Reinig, statistics by Mark Southcott.) Drivers, personalities and attractions included in the book: Richie Evans, Jackie Soper (Lancasters first feature winner), Dutch Hoag, Roger Treichler, Geoff Bodine, Bill Rafter, Merv Treichler, Don Diffendorf, Maynard Troyer, Jean-Guy Chartrand, Bob Santos, Ray Hendrick, Lee Osborne, Jerry Cook, Chuck Boos, Lou Lazzaro, Jim Shampine, Bill Bitterman, Ted Renshaw, Jim Rudolph, beloved promoter Ed Serwacki, Buffalos Civic Stadium, Cam Gagliardi, the Astro-Spiral Car, Ron Lux, Sonny Barron, Bill Brainard, Ron Martin, Bryan Osgood, Gary Iulg, Jim Howard, Jim McGraw, Ross Holmes, Bobby Hudson, Frankie "$8" Smith, Mike Loescher, Leo Lewandowski, Sege Fidanza, Satch Worley, Late Models, Mini-Stocks, TQ Midgets and drag racing on the 1/8-mile strip. Includes seven pages of detailed stats (wins, championships) and an original Bruce Roll cartoon!
